64  /**
65   * The standard "transfer", "fetch", "protocol", "receive", and "uploadpack"
66   * configuration parameters.
67   */
68  public class TransferConfig {
69  	private static final String FSCK = "fsck"; //$NON-NLS-1$
70  
71  	/** Key for {@link Config#get(SectionParser)}. */
72  	public static final Config.SectionParser<TransferConfig> KEY =
73  			TransferConfig::new;
74  
75  	/**
76  	 * A git configuration value for how to handle a fsck failure of a particular kind.
77  	 * Used in e.g. fsck.missingEmail.
78  	 * @since 4.9
79  	 */
80  	public enum FsckMode {
81  		/**
82  		 * Treat it as an error (the default).
83  		 */
84  		ERROR,
85  		/**
86  		 * Issue a warning (in fact, jgit treats this like IGNORE, but git itself does warn).
87  		 */
88  		WARN,
89  		/**
90  		 * Ignore the error.
91  		 */
92  		IGNORE;
93  	}
94  
95  	/**
96  	 * A git configuration variable for which versions of the Git protocol to prefer.
97  	 * Used in protocol.version.
98  	 */
99  	enum ProtocolVersion {
100 		V0("0"), //$NON-NLS-1$
101 		V2("2"); //$NON-NLS-1$
102 
103 		final String name;
104 
105 		ProtocolVersion(String name) {
106 			this.name = name;
107 		}
108 
109 		static @Nullable ProtocolVersion parse(@Nullable String name) {
110 			if (name == null) {
111 				return null;
112 			}
113 			for (ProtocolVersion v : ProtocolVersion.values()) {
114 				if (v.name.equals(name)) {
115 					return v;
116 				}
117 			}
118 			return null;
119 		}
120 	}

136 	/**
137 	 * Create a configuration honoring the repository's settings.
138 	 *
139 	 * @param db
140 	 *            the repository to read settings from. The repository is not
141 	 *            retained by the new configuration, instead its settings are
142 	 *            copied during the constructor.
143 	 * @since 5.1.4
144 	 */
145 	public TransferConfig(Repository db) {
146 		this(db.getConfig());
147 	}
148 
149 	/**
150 	 * Create a configuration honoring settings in a
151 	 * {@link org.eclipse.jgit.lib.Config}.
152 	 *
153 	 * @param rc
154 	 *            the source to read settings from. The source is not retained
155 	 *            by the new configuration, instead its settings are copied
156 	 *            during the constructor.
157 	 * @since 5.1.4
158 	 */
159 	@SuppressWarnings("nls")
160 	public TransferConfig(Config rc) {
161 		boolean fsck = rc.getBoolean("transfer", "fsckobjects", false);
162 		fetchFsck = rc.getBoolean("fetch", "fsckobjects", fsck);
163 		receiveFsck = rc.getBoolean("receive", "fsckobjects", fsck);
164 		fsckSkipList = rc.getString(FSCK, null, "skipList");
165 		allowInvalidPersonIdent = rc.getBoolean(FSCK, "allowInvalidPersonIdent",
166 				false);
167 		safeForWindows = rc.getBoolean(FSCK, "safeForWindows",
168 						SystemReader.getInstance().isWindows());
169 		safeForMacOS = rc.getBoolean(FSCK, "safeForMacOS",
170 						SystemReader.getInstance().isMacOS());
171 
172 		ignore = EnumSet.noneOf(ObjectChecker.ErrorType.class);
173 		EnumSet<ObjectChecker.ErrorType> set = EnumSet
174 				.noneOf(ObjectChecker.ErrorType.class);
175 		for (String key : rc.getNames(FSCK)) {
176 			if (equalsIgnoreCase(key, "skipList")
177 					|| equalsIgnoreCase(key, "allowLeadingZeroFileMode")
178 					|| equalsIgnoreCase(key, "allowInvalidPersonIdent")
179 					|| equalsIgnoreCase(key, "safeForWindows")
180 					|| equalsIgnoreCase(key, "safeForMacOS")) {
181 				continue;
182 			}
183 
184 			ObjectChecker.ErrorType id = FsckKeyNameHolder.parse(key);
185 			if (id != null) {
186 				switch (rc.getEnum(FSCK, null, key, FsckMode.ERROR)) {
187 				case ERROR:
188 					ignore.remove(id);
189 					break;
190 				case WARN:
191 				case IGNORE:
192 					ignore.add(id);
193 					break;
194 				}
195 				set.add(id);
196 			}
197 		}
198 		if (!set.contains(ObjectChecker.ErrorType.ZERO_PADDED_FILEMODE)
199 				&& rc.getBoolean(FSCK, "allowLeadingZeroFileMode", false)) {
200 			ignore.add(ObjectChecker.ErrorType.ZERO_PADDED_FILEMODE);
201 		}
202 
203 		allowRefInWant = rc.getBoolean("uploadpack", "allowrefinwant", false);
204 		allowTipSha1InWant = rc.getBoolean(
205 				"uploadpack", "allowtipsha1inwant", false);
206 		allowReachableSha1InWant = rc.getBoolean(
207 				"uploadpack", "allowreachablesha1inwant", false);
208 		allowFilter = rc.getBoolean(
209 				"uploadpack", "allowfilter", false);
210 		protocolVersion = ProtocolVersion.parse(rc.getString("protocol", null, "version"));
211 		hideRefs = rc.getStringList("uploadpack", null, "hiderefs");
212 	}
